Choose Clay when you need growth and sales operations teams building custom enrichment and outbound pipelines with AI research. Choose Zapier AI when you need cross-app business automation, lead routing, operations, content workflows, and lightweight agents.

Should I choose Clay or Zapier AI?+

Choose Clay when you need growth and sales operations teams building custom enrichment and outbound pipelines with AI research. Choose Zapier AI when you need cross-app business automation, lead routing, operations, content workflows, and lightweight agents.
